Atera Raises $77M in Series B Funding

  • Atera, an Eindhoven, The Netherlands, NYC- and Tel Aviv, Israel-based remote-first IT management company, raised $77m in Series B funding
  • The round was led by General Atlantic, with participation from K1 Investment Management
  • The company intends to use the funds for further global expansion and development of new products
  • The company provides a platform that combines remote monitoring and management (RMM) with help desk, reporting
  • Over the past year, the company has reached a new milestone of securing over 7,000 total customers worldwide in over 90 countries
